    12. A corpse can bloat and swell up to almost double in size within a few days of dying, due to a buildup of gases in the body during decomposition.

    13. There are more ways to shuffle a standard deck of cards than there are atoms on Earth. As a result, every time you shuffle a deck of cards, you're probably the first person in history to shuffle them in that sequence.
